Baskin: A new poster has been revealed for Can Evrenol's Baskin, which is set to premiere at Toronto International Film Festival (Tiff) next Friday, September 11th. The film stars Gorkem Kasal, Ergun Kuyucu, Mehmet Cerrahoglu, Sabahattin Yakut, Mehmet Fatih Dokgoz, and Muharrem Bayrak.
"Five cops, working the graveyard shift in the middle of nowhere are dispatched to investigate a disturbance. Isolated and without backup they find themselves confronting a labyrinthine ruin. Pushing ever further into the depths of the lair, it becomes clear they have stumbled into the darkest pits of a terrible evil. A squalid and blood-soaked den of ritual...

Wild Eye Releasing will be unleashing Shane Ryan's latest film, My Name is A by anonymous, on September 23, 2014. A tells the inspired-by-true-story of Alyssa Bustamante, who was accused of stabbing, strangling, and slicing the throat of her 9 year old neighbor. Alyssa was just 15 at the time of the murder.
